top of page

Send a message with your question or comment

CONTACT

US

Tel. 512-771-8601

Tel. 512-771-8608

1225 E Rosemeade Parkway

Carrollton, TX 75007

​

VISIT

US

Friday 11:00 - 22:30

Saturday 11:00 - 22:00

Sunday 12:30 - 22:30 

 

TELL

US

Thanks for submitting!

bottom of page